Gone are the days of bulky, wind-resistant side mirrors that rattle at highway speeds. Our e-mirror system replaces traditional glass mirrors with high-resolution digital displays, giving drivers a wider, clearer view of their surroundings—even in harsh weather. Available in long and short arm designs to fit trucks, buses, and commercial vehicles of all sizes, these electronic side mirrors eliminate blind spots by up to 90% compared to conventional mirrors.
How do they work? Compact, weatherproof cameras mounted on the truck's exterior capture real-time footage, which is displayed on sleek, anti-glare screens inside the cab. No more squinting through rain-streaked glass or dealing with mirror vibration. Plus, with adjustable brightness and contrast, drivers can customize the display to match lighting conditions—whether it's bright sunlight or pitch-black night.
For fleet operators, the benefits go beyond safety: e-mirrors reduce aerodynamic drag, improving fuel efficiency by up to 5% on long-haul routes. It's a win-win for safety and savings.

Even the best cameras can't cover every angle—that's where proximity sensors come in. These small but powerful devices detect objects in the truck's path, alerting drivers with audible or visual warnings before a collision occurs. Whether it's a pedestrian stepping out from between parked cars or a low wall in a loading yard, our proximity sensors act as an extra layer of protection, especially in tight spaces.
Our ultrasonic parking sensors, for example, are embedded in the truck's bumper and use sound waves to measure distance to nearby objects. As the truck approaches an obstacle, the system beeps faster—giving drivers precise feedback without taking their eyes off the road. For larger vehicles like buses and tractor-trailers, we offer heavy-duty proximity sensors with adjustable detection ranges, ensuring they work reliably even with the truck's size and weight.

While our focus is on trucks, we understand that safety knows no bounds. That's why we also offer car avm system (Around View Monitoring) solutions for passenger vehicles, as well as truck-specific AVM systems that provide a bird's-eye view of the vehicle and its surroundings. Using four wide-angle cameras mounted on the front, rear, and sides, these systems stitch together a 360° live feed, making parking, maneuvering, and navigating tight spaces a breeze.
Imagine trying to park a semi-truck in a crowded city lot—with an AVM system, you'll see every inch of the area around your truck, eliminating the guesswork and reducing the risk of scrapes or collisions. It's a game-changer for drivers of all experience levels.
Trucks operate in some of the harshest environments on Earth—from scorching deserts to freezing mountain passes, from dusty construction sites to salt-sprayed coastal highways. That's why every component we build is tested to withstand the extremes. Here's what makes our products tough enough for the road:
Our cameras and sensors carry IP67 or IP68 ratings, meaning they're dust-tight and can withstand submersion in water up to 1.5 meters for 30 minutes. No more worrying about rain, snow, or pressure washes.
Many of our cameras use Sony Starvis or Exmor sensors, which capture clear, color images in light as low as 0.001 lux—so dark, you can barely see your hand in front of your face.
From 12V cars to 36V trucks and buses, our systems work with a range of vehicle electrical systems, eliminating the need for voltage converters.
Built with rugged materials like metal and reinforced plastic, our products can handle the constant vibration of off-road driving and heavy-duty use.
